KM Recruitment is a specialist UK wide recruiter for the Skills and Employability sectors.Job Title: Teaching Assistant Trainer Assessor (Trainee or Qualified)Location: Home/Field based - Must be flexible with travel across LondonSalary: up to £37,000 - inclusive of location uplift (Depending on qualifications and experience)Package includes: Excellent Holiday Entitlement, Mileage + much more!Type: Full time, PermanentKM have an exciting opportunity for an experienced Teaching Assistant/Teacher, who possesses Leadership and Management experience, who would like to transition in to a new and rewarding career within the training industry to support Apprentices! Essential Criteria:

  • Must have experience of working at Management level within a School setting, with experience of managing staff (e.g. as a Head Teacher / Deputy Head Teacher)
  • Must have experience of working as a Teacher or Teaching Assistant (minimum of 3 years).
  • Must hold a minimum of a Level 5 qualification in Education (e.g. PGCE/CertEd/QTS etc.)
  • Must hold a minimum of a Level 2 English and Maths / GCSE equivalents.
  • Experience of delivering on-the-job training to staff would be highly desirable.
  • Organisational skills are a must, as well as the ability to plan your time effectively.
  • Confident and professional with the ability to inspire and motivate people.
  • Must be flexible with travel.

Duties include:

  • Delivering full Teaching Assistant Apprenticeship Standards L3-L5, and Operations Departmental Manager L5.
  • Manage a caseload of learners, conduct remote and face to face observations to gather evidence towards their Apprenticeships.
  • Managing your diary efficiently to ensure timely reviews and completions.
  • Support learners through the End Point Assessment Process.
  • Organise and maintain documentation on learners' progress.
  • Support, advise and motivate learners.
  • Overcome barriers to learning and adapt delivery to meet learner’s needs.
  • Meet Assessor KPI’s in terms of timely visits, reviews, learner progression, quality paperwork and general administration.
